A Christchurch man whose partner died just after the birth of their baby has been left struggling to get paid parental leave
8 May 2018
The baby was born at 33 weeks by C-section.
His father who wants to be known as Keith, works full-time and applied for paid parental leave.
He's now facing a heartbreaking decision - after MBIE told him he can't get it because his partner had been a stay-at-home mum - and SHE wasn't entitled.
Keith says one option is to give up his job and go on the DPB which he doesn't want to do, because his employer has been very supportive.
In a letter, the Ministry of Business Innovation and Development told Keith it understands how unfair the situation is, and its policy team is now aware of the gap in the legislation.
